What is MOVE Guides?
MOVE Guides addresses the complexities of global workforce mobility by providing a comprehensive platform that reduces barriers between people and places. Serving over 100 global enterprises, including prominent names like Procore, Societe Generale, and Slack, the company offers integrated solutions for relocation management, expatriate administration, tax and payroll services, and immigration data. Its platform is designed to optimize operational efficiencies, ensure compliance, and elevate employee satisfaction and engagement. Founded in 2012, MOVE Guides has consistently attracted substantial investment to fuel its mission of enabling work everywhere. The company also operates a philanthropic initiative, Mobility4All, dedicating a percentage of its revenue and employee time to programs assisting those affected by poverty and conflict.
How much funding has MOVE Guides raised?
MOVE Guides has raised a total of $73.6M across 4 funding rounds:

Angel/Seed (2013): $1.8M with participation from New Enterprise Associates and Notion Capital
Series A (2014): $8.2M led by New Enterprise Associates and Notion Capital
Series B (2015): $15.6M supported by New Enterprise Associates and Notion Capital
Series C (2017): $48M featuring Notion Capital and New Enterprise Associates
Key Investors in MOVE Guides
New Enterprise Associates
New Enterprise Associates (NEA) is a prominent venture capital firm established in 1977, headquartered in Menlo Park, California. NEA specializes in providing capital and strategic support to entrepreneurs across various stages of business development, with a focus on building impactful companies.
Notion Capital
Notion Capital is a leading early-stage venture capital firm based in London, specializing in investments in B2B SaaS and cloud services across Europe. The firm provides investment capital and expert support to help ambitious brands scale their ventures, focusing on building strong, long-term relationships with founders.
